Default basic modifications with #'s

So I was watching Horsepower TV today and just figured I'd jot down their conclusions.

They took a bone stock '92 5.0l notchback and dyno'd it at 191 rwhp.
then they changed the following:

-Distributor, Ignition, Optimum battery. 4 rhwp gain

-Cold air intake, 70mm Throttle body, High flow EGR plate. 9 rwhp gain

-Bbk equal length headers, 2 ½” Bbk x pipe with cats, Flowmaster American
Thunder 2 ½ “ exhaust. 14 rwhp gain

-Underdrive pullies. 5 rwhp gain


Just thought I'd share...
